How they compare
Saint Barthelemy currently reports 1,921 people against 1,763 people in Anguilla, a difference of 158 people.
That makes Saint Barthelemy's figure about 1.1 times Anguilla's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 74 shared years of data; in 1950 it was Anguilla ahead.
Anguilla ranks 225th and Saint Barthelemy ranks 223rd of 236 countries.
Across the 8 decades both report, Anguilla averaged higher in 7 and Saint Barthelemy in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Anguilla | Saint Barthelemy |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1950s | 245 people | 155.5 people | 89.5 people | Anguilla |
| 1960s | 437.8 people | 165.6 people | 272.2 people | Anguilla |
| 1970s | 558.3 people | 157.7 people | 400.6 people | Anguilla |
| 1980s | 712.4 people | 173 people | 539.4 people | Anguilla |
| 1990s | 755 people | 400.3 people | 354.7 people | Anguilla |
| 2000s | 860.7 people | 728.5 people | 132.2 people | Anguilla |
| 2010s | 1,161 people | 965.6 people | 195.5 people | Anguilla |
| 2020s | 1,638 people | 1,783 people | 145.5 people | Saint Barthelemy |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
